In the tbdb.other_annotations.csv file, I found that different who_confidence were assigned to the same mutation in the same gene. The following are the examples I spotted:
Gene Mutation Type Info
whiB6 c.-75del who_confidence drug=amikacin;who_confidence=Not assoc w R
whiB6 c.-75del who_confidence drug=amikacin;who_confidence=Uncertain significance
Gene Mutation Type Info
Rv1258c c.580_581insC who_confidence drug=isoniazid;who_confidence=Uncertain significance
Rv1258c c.580_581insC who_confidence drug=isoniazid;who_confidence=Not assoc w R
Rv1258c c.580_581insC who_confidence drug=streptomycin;who_confidence=Uncertain significance
Rv1258c c.580_581insC who_confidence drug=streptomycin;who_confidence=Not assoc w R
Rv1258c c.580_581insC who_confidence drug=pyrazinamide;who_confidence=Uncertain significance
Rv1258c c.580_581insC who_confidence drug=pyrazinamide;who_confidence=Not assoc w R
